答辩超人sbcan 2024-09-09 20:48 采纳率: 100%
浏览 1
已结题

python——turtle

又是一个新问题,怎么改掉文件太大,让这个turtle跑起来把图片画出来!

img

  • 写回答

1条回答 默认 最新

  • 一轮明月照丘壑 2024-09-09 20:49
    关注

    以下回复参考:皆我百晓生券券喵儿等免费微信小程序作答:

    从您给出的内容来看,您似乎是在使用Python的turtle模块来绘制图形,但是遇到了文件过大的问题。为了解决这个问题并成功运行您的代码,您可以尝试以下几个步骤:

    步骤 1:检查代码完整性

    首先,请确保您的代码完整并格式正确。看起来代码有些混乱和不完整,您需要确保所有的代码行都有意义并且能够执行。移除那些无关的代码行,比如乱码和重复的代码段。

    步骤 2:简化代码

    如果您的代码过于复杂或者包含冗余的部分,这可能会导致文件过大或者运行缓慢。尝试简化您的代码,移除不必要的部分并确定代码的结构清晰。例如,确定是否所有的函数和方法都是必要的,并且它们的实现是高效的。

    步骤 3:优化图片大小和绘制速度

    如果您正在使用turtle模块来绘制图像或图形,可以考虑以下几点来优化图像大小和绘制速度:

    • 使用较小的画布尺寸(canvas size):您已经设置了canvasxcanvasY的值,确保这些值适合您的需求并且不会过大。
    • 调整绘图速度:使用turtle.speed()函数来设置绘图速度。虽然设置为0(最快)可能会加快绘图速度,但也可能导致图像质量下降。根据您的需求进行权衡。
    • 优化颜色设置:使用turtle.colormode()设置颜色模式时,确保您真正需要使用255个颜色。如果不必要,可以尝试使用更少的颜色来减少文件大小。
    • 考虑分批绘制复杂图形:如果您正在绘制复杂的图形,可以考虑分批次绘制各个部分而不是一次性完成。这样可以将大任务分解成小任务,减少内存使用并提高性能。

    步骤 4:保存文件大小问题

    关于文件太大这个问题,可能是因为您的代码文件包含了大量的不必要信息或者注释等。尝试清理代码文件,移除不必要的注释和空白行,以减小文件大小。此外,确保您的编辑器或IDE没有将不必要的元数据或隐藏字符保存到文件中。

    步骤 5:运行测试和优化性能

    在优化代码和减小文件大小后,尝试运行测试以检查性能和稳定性。如果问题仍然存在或出现了新的问题,您可以考虑查看相关的文档和教程以获取更多帮助和建议。此外,也可以考虑在相关的开发者社区或论坛上寻求帮助。

    总之,解决文件过大和运行turtle的问题需要一系列的步骤和策略。尝试按照上述步骤操作,并根据您的具体情况进行调整和优化。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 系统已结题 9月18日
  • 已采纳回答 9月10日
  • 创建了问题 9月9日